No need to look at your work as reparenting, but you know a critical role of parents is the one you're having your therapist take on right now- helping you to be independent and build your own identity- that's a key developmental stage in adolescence. It doesn't always happen due to the codependence and other issues common with alcoholic parents. It's something good parents model and encourage often indirectly.
